Bouygues Energies & Services, is part of the Bouygues Group – a global brand employing over 130,000 people in 80 countries within the construction, engineering, civil works, energy services, telecommunications and media sectors.
Bouygues Energies & Services specialise in the execution of technically challenging, time sensitive projects and offer seamless consulting and facility solutions through an inhouse design, build, operate and maintain delivery model.
